Beloved odd-couple Penguin and Panda return in four new adventures. Whether it’s Penguin’s first campout (in the dark!) or her strange competition with the new neighbor, she is definitely feeling all the feels. Panda, Mr. Low-Key, is always happy to offer up sage wisdom, but his inability to stop putting things off comes back to bite him when he ruins a special Fun Friday.

Brenda Maier

Brenda Maier is a children’s author, gifted education specialist, and mother of five not-so-little offspring who now range from high school to grad school. As a child, Brenda never thought she could attend college; because of that, she loves sharing the story of how she made her own dreams of being a teacher and author come true.Brenda currently teaches at a public school and is a board member of OAGCT, the Oklahoma affiliate of the National Association for Gifted Children. Among her books are the picture book folktale retellings THE LITTLE RED FORT, THE LITTLE BLUE BRIDGE, and THE LITTLE GREEN SWING and the early graphic chapter book series THE ADVENTURES OF PENGUIN AND PANDA. She lives in Northeast Oklahoma with her family and enjoys visiting classrooms around the country to share her passion for reading, writing, and goal-setting. Fanni Mézes is an artist living in Budapest, Hungary. After graduating university as a product design engineer, she pivoted to art school and set out to illustrate books for young readers.
